What do you call the process of a flower making a seed through pollination?

Respuesta :

ayoobaby200
ayoobaby200 ayoobaby200
  • 17-02-2021

Pollination process occurs when pollen grains from the male part of one flower (anther) are transferred to the female part (stigma) of another flower. Once pollination occurs, the fertilized flowers produce seeds, which enable the associated plant to reproduce and/or form fruit.
